How to Transform Timestamp To Date Efficiently

Every developer, tips analyst, or tech fanatic has confronted it: an extended string of numbers like 1672531200 in region of an proper date. These numbers are timestamps, representing seconds when you consider that January 1, 1970, referred to as the Unix epoch. On their possess, they are special however opaque. Converting them to readable dates seriously isn't only a comfort—it’s serious for examining logs, coping with databases, and syncing approaches across unique time zones.

Why Timestamp To Date Conversion Matters

Timestamps are in all places, from server logs in New York to IoT sensor info in Berlin. They enable machines to manner situations correctly, yet human beings want context. Imagine monitoring a website online’s traffic and seeing a spike at 1681344000. Without conversion, it’s impossible to correlate that spike with genuinely user habits or regional activities.

Conversion from timestamp thus far bridges this gap. It turns uncooked computer records into insights that persons can act on, whether or not for debugging code, generating experiences, or tracking economic transactions. Businesses counting on truly-time analytics, fantastically in global operations, cannot have the funds for ambiguity in time statistics.

Common Use Cases for Timestamp To Date Conversion

Understanding whilst occasions took place is the ordinary motive, but real looking purposes delay further. A few eventualities illustrate this:

  • Server Logs: Determining good times for machine mistakes or get admission to routine.
  • Database Management: Converting saved epoch values for reporting or integration.
  • Data Analysis: Aggregating metrics via day, week, or month.
  • Global Collaboration: Coordinating pursuits across assorted time zones.
  • Financial Transactions: Verifying timestamps in buying and selling methods or blockchain logs.

Each of those cases blessings from excellent timestamp so far conversion. Even a minor misalignment can end in hours of confusion when interpreting knowledge.

Technical Insights: How Timestamp Conversion Works

A timestamp is a remember of seconds (or milliseconds) from the epoch. Converting it to a date contains three steps:

  1. Determine the unit: seconds or milliseconds.
  2. Apply the precise time region offset, if useful.
  3. Format the resulting date string in a human-readable trend.

Most programming languages present integrated utilities for this manner. In Python, you could possibly use datetime.fromtimestamp(), at the same time as JavaScript promises new Date(). For intricate techniques, certainly the ones processing thousands of occasions in keeping with day, precise and powerfuble conversion becomes a valuable engineering decision.

Time Zones and Daylight Savings

Conversion is not as clear-cut as simply formatting numbers. Time zones and sunlight mark downs introduce delicate demanding situations. A timestamp that represents midnight UTC would correspond to the old evening in Los Angeles or the early morning in Tokyo. For organisations with clients across continents, failing to account for regional time ameliorations can reason misinterpretation of records and consumer task.

Practical Tips for Reliable Timestamp Conversion

Even skilled builders sometimes put out of your mind these reasonable concerns:

  • Always be certain the unit: Confusing seconds with milliseconds can produce dates hundreds of thousands of years off.
  • Include specific time zones: Never anticipate the technique defaults match your audience.
  • Standardize formatting: ISO 8601 is largely followed and reduces ambiguity.
  • Test aspect instances: Leap years, daylight hours savings, and end-of-month calculations.
  • Use respectable libraries: Avoid ad-hoc calculations for venture-crucial programs.

Timestamp To Date in Real-World Applications

Consider an e-commerce platform monitoring orders throughout Europe and the U.S. The raw order timestamps are kept in UTC. Customer toughen sellers in Berlin desire the neighborhood order time to deal with inquiries effectually. By changing timestamps to human-readable dates with the right kind time zone applied, groups can respond sooner and with fewer errors. This will not be theoretical—it’s operational effectivity.

Another illustration comes from IoT analytics. A shrewdpermanent vigor grid in California collects sensor readings every moment. Engineers studying overall performance need to correlate activities with grid anomalies in neighborhood time, not UTC. Proper timestamp conversion makes it possible for them to title styles and act in the past minor concerns enhance into outages.

Choosing the Right Tool for Conversion

There are many methods to transform timestamps, from programming libraries to online utilities. The preference relies on context:

  1. For developers: Language-exclusive libraries (Python, JavaScript, Java) furnish programmatic flexibility.
  2. For analysts: Spreadsheet features in Excel or Google Sheets maintain batch conversion effectively.
  3. For swift exams: Online converters are immediate, dependableremember, and remove the probability of guide miscalculations.

The secret's consistency. Using a relied on, standardized procedure guarantees that dates stay accurate throughout all tactics and stories.

Future-Proofing Timestamp Handling

As methods turned into a growing number of international, precision in time handling grows in importance. Cloud platforms, microservices, and disbursed databases require constant timestamp to date conversions to avoid cascading errors. Engineers more and more rely upon automatic pipelines that validate and convert timestamps beforehand they succeed in determination-makers. This reduces the danger of misinterpretation and complements operational reliability.

In life like phrases, this implies integrating conversion instruments into dashboards, logs, and analytics pipelines. Even a minor misalignment in time handling can ripple using reporting, billing, and efficiency tracking, chiefly whilst assorted areas are concerned.

Conclusion: Making Timestamps Useful

Working with timestamps is more than a technical activity. It is about readability, accuracy, and operational performance. Whether you are analyzing server logs, monitoring worldwide tactics, or interpreting user conduct, converting timestamps to readable dates is foremost for counseled choices. For all of us desiring a respectable, gentle-to-use solution, Timestamp To Date presents a straightforward device to radically change uncooked epoch numbers into significant human-readable dates, helping clients save time and decrease error in both legit and private projects.